Michael
My truck has had the chassis strengthened at the front shock mount and the rear vaccum tank has had a welding repair where the round pipe meets the chassis rail. The front shock mount was done before I owned the truck and hasn't given me any problem. The vaccum tank had been repaired also but I have also had it welded again, took me a while to work out why my diff locks weren't working all the time. I regularly carted 1.25 t loads over some steep tracks that would have made the chassis flex.
